Nevada
Nevada is an arid state of the US, lying between California and Utah. Most of the state is within the Great Basin, but parts of the northeast drain into the Snake River and the southern portion is within the Mohave Desert and the Colorado river drainage.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Las Vegas
Photo: Pcb21,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Situated in the midst of the southern Nevada desert, Las Vegas is the largest city in the state of Nevada. Nicknamed Sin City, Las Vegas and its surrounding communities are famed for their mega-casino resorts, often lavishly decorated with names and themes meant to evoke romance, mystery, and exotic destinations.

Reno
Photo: Phoebe,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Reno, the "Biggest Little City in the World", is in the beautiful north-west region of the State of Nevada, right at the base of the Sierra Nevada mountain range.

Southern Nevada
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Southern Nevada is a region of Nevada. Most famous for Las Vegas, this region is also home to Area 51, beautiful rocky canyons, and barren desert landscapes. It comprises Clark County, Esmeralda County, Lincoln County, Mineral County, and Nye County.

Northern Nevada
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Northern Nevada consists of dry, mountainous, sparsely populated landscapes. Most of the towns are dotted along the Humboldt River, Interstate 80, and the railroad, all of which cut across this part of Nevada from west to east, running next to each other for much of the way.
Central Nevada
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Central Nevada in Nevada is the region surrounding the Loneliest Road in America, including small settlements, mountain ranges and large plateaus in between.
